An integral effect test program for the SMART design: VISTA-ITL

  • 1. Thermal Hydraulics Safety Research Division, Koreat Atomic Energy Research Institute - KAERI, 1045 Daedeok-daero, Yuseong-gu, Daejeon 305-353 (Korea, Republic of)

Description

A thermal-hydraulic integral effect test program for the SMART (System-integrated Modular Advanced Reactor) design has been introduced, it is called VISTA-ITL. The VISTA-ITL is a small-scale integral effect test facility for the SMART design and it has the following characteristics: 1/2.77-height, 1/1310-volume and full pressure and temperature simulation of the SMART design. The VISTA-ITL will be used extensively to assess the safety and performance of the SMART design and to validate various thermal-hydraulic analysis codes such as the MARS and TASS/SMR. As a typical scenario of SBLOCA (Small-Break Loss of Coolant Accident) the safety injection line break accident has been analyzed with the MARS-KS code, to assess a thermal-hydraulic similarity between the SMART design and the VISTA-ITL facility. The present similarity analysis ascertained the thermal-hydraulic similarity between the SMART design and the VISTA-ITL facility and provided a good insight into the unique features of the VISTA-ITL and the thermal-hydraulic characteristics of the SMART design as well.
